Introduction

The Ryder Cup, one of golf’s most prestigious events, sees head-to-head competition between teams from Europe and the United States. Scheduled for 2025, the upcoming tournament will be hosted at the iconic Bethpage Black course in New York. The selection of team captains is crucial as they play a pivotal role in strategy, motivation, and team dynamics, ultimately influencing the athletes’ performance on the course.

Significance of Captaincy

The influence of captains in the Ryder Cup cannot be overstated. The captains are responsible for making strategic decisions such as pairings for matches and managing player lineup changes based on form and fitness. Their ability to inspire and foster teamwork amongst players can significantly affect the outcome of the tournament.

Moreover, both the European and American teams have been immersed in adapting to the changes and pressures of modern golf, including the rising competition from players joining rival leagues. Thus, strong leadership will be essential to galvanise the players around a unified goal.
